The image captures a coastal landscape in Chwaka, Tanzania, severely impacted by pollution. The foreground is dominated by an extensive, dense accumulation of discarded waste, including numerous plastic bottles, bags, wrappers, and other refuse, mixed with dry, thorny branches and sparse vegetation. Beyond this vast expanse of trash, a body of water, likely a bay or ocean, stretches into the background. Several small, simple boats or canoes are visible dotted across the water's surface. On the near side of the water, a natural bank with green trees and bushes provides a narrow strip of less-polluted nature, but the encroaching trash is evident at the water's edge. The far shore is indistinct but suggests a continuation of land. The sky is overcast or hazy, with a few faint clouds, giving the scene a soft, subdued light, suggesting either early morning or late afternoon. No people are visible in the image. Notable details include the overwhelming scale of the waste pile in the foreground, highlighting a significant environmental issue. Amidst the debris, a red can, possibly a Coca-Cola can, is faintly discernible. The scene conveys a sense of environmental degradation and neglect, contrasting the natural beauty of the coastal setting with human-generated pollution.
